Why Waterproof Curtain For Shower Window is Necessary

I’ve found that a waterproof curtain for a shower window is necessary because it helps protect my bathroom from constant moisture. When water splashes from the shower or steam builds up, a regular curtain can quickly soak through, which may lead to damp walls, peeling paint, and even mold growth. A waterproof curtain gives me peace of mind by creating a strong barrier against water damage.

I also like that it helps keep my bathroom cleaner and easier to maintain. My shower area stays drier, and I don’t have to worry as much about wiping down the window or dealing with water stains. Since the curtain resists moisture, it lasts longer and saves me from replacing it too often.

Another reason I consider it important is privacy. My shower window can let in light, but I still want to feel comfortable while bathing. A waterproof curtain gives me both privacy and protection, which makes my bathroom more practical and enjoyable to use every day.

My Buying Guides on Waterproof Curtain For Shower Window

Why I Look for a Waterproof Curtain for a Shower Window

When I shop for a waterproof curtain for a shower window, my main goal is to stop water from splashing onto the window area while still keeping the space looking neat. I want something that can handle daily moisture, dry quickly, and help protect the window frame from mold, mildew, and water damage.

Material Is the First Thing I Check

For me, the material matters most. I usually look for polyester, vinyl, PEVA, or other water-resistant fabrics. I prefer a curtain that feels durable and does not soak up water easily. If I want a softer look, I choose a fabric curtain with a waterproof coating. If I want maximum water protection, I lean toward vinyl or PEVA.

I Pay Attention to Size and Fit

I always measure my shower window before buying. A curtain that is too short leaves gaps, and one that is too long can look messy or get in the way. I check both the width and height carefully so the curtain covers the window properly. If the window is an unusual size, I look for adjustable or customizable options.

I Prefer Easy Installation

I like curtains that are simple to install. Depending on my setup, I may choose suction cups, adhesive hooks, tension rods, or traditional curtain rods. I usually pick the option that gives me a secure fit without damaging the wall or window frame.

Opacity and Privacy Matter to Me

If the shower window faces outside or another room, I look for a curtain that gives me enough privacy. I may choose frosted, semi-opaque, or blackout styles depending on how much light I want to keep. I try to balance privacy with natural light so the bathroom does not feel too dark.

I Check for Mold and Mildew Resistance

Because bathrooms stay damp, I always look for mold-resistant and mildew-resistant features. This helps the curtain stay cleaner and last longer. I also prefer materials that dry quickly, since that reduces the chance of unpleasant odors and stains.

Cleaning Should Be Simple

I do not want a curtain that is hard to maintain. I usually choose one that I can wipe clean, rinse, or machine wash easily. If a curtain needs too much special care, I know I will probably avoid using it for long.

Style Still Matters to Me

Even though function comes first, I still want the curtain to match my bathroom. I look at color, pattern, and texture so it blends well with the rest of the space. A simple design often works best for me because it looks clean and timeless.

Durability Is Worth the Investment

I do not mind spending a little more if the curtain is built to last. Strong stitching, reinforced edges, rust-resistant rings, and thick material are all signs that the product may hold up better over time. In my experience, a durable curtain saves money in the long run.

My Final Buying Tip

When I choose a waterproof curtain for a shower window, I focus on the right mix of water protection, fit, privacy, and easy care. If I measure carefully and choose a material that suits my bathroom, I usually end up with a curtain that works well and looks good too.
